I have prime hd and 70% blues and 10% white, are these BTAs reaching for more light or food?
1739860490699.png
 
They look happy to me. Some bubble don't so long waving tentacles don't really mean they are stretching for light if that's what you're thinking. IME if bubble tips are not happy with the conditions they will move around searching for a spot they like. If yours are not moving then they are happy. FWIW I never fed mine anything but light and whatever they catch out of the water column.
